The fairytale “Jack and the Beanstalk” tells the story of a boy Jack who lives in a very poor family. The only way of getting food and money is their cow – Milky-white. But one day they have no money and Jack has to go to the market and sell Milky-white “to start shop, or something”. There Jack meets an old man who knows his name. They start chatting and the old man asks Jack to sell him a cow for five magical beans. The magic of beans is that if you sow it, they grow way up to the sky. Jack agrees and goes back home. His mother gets angry cause that Jack didn’t get any money and throws the beans away. But the next morning Jack sees a huge beanstalk and understands that the old man told him the truth. He climbs all the way to the top and finds something strange...
